Brigaldara presents the new 2022 vintage of Valpolicella Doc Case Viecie, a distinctive expression of the Valpolicella luogo and more precisely of the Cru homonymous. Case Viecie is a treasure chest of biodiversity, nestled among the high hills of the municipality of Grezzana and represents the agricultural bet of the Cesari family to create a vital environment immersed durante an altitude ecosystem, which exceeds 450 meters.
This label was born within the project started durante 2016 with the aim of expressing the territorial identity of the Valpolicella through the winemaking of fresh grapes, without the use of the teasing. The 2022 harvest marks a further step forward durante this direction, thanks to a year that has favored concentration and structure, preserving freshness and balance.

The high temperatures and the prolonged absence of rains led to a reduction of the yields, directly influencing production: 20,000 bottles have been produced for this vintage, compared to the 30,000 of previous years. Despite the challenging climatic conditions, the Valpolicella Doc Case Vacie 2022 has been able to express the best potential of the territory, influenced by the altimetry and the presence of the woods, guaranteeing a result of great quality.
“Once considered an extreme territory for viticulture, Vacie houses today proves to be optimal thanks to climate change. The 2022 was a decidedly dry year. However, the September rains have provided the necessary vater to complete the maturation cycle. The lower made and the consequent concertation of the grapes have allowed to obtain a Valpolicella capable of putting together a good structure, an excellent drinking, revealing the sensorial complexity. The result of a slow maturation of the grapes and important thermal excursions between the day and night. ” – explains Antonio Cesari.
Vacie houses, a unique vineyard for targeted production
Case Viecie is an luogo of great wine potential, thanks to its high position and the lower temperatures compared to the surrounding areas that make it similar to a mountain environment. These factors allow a slower maturation of the grapes (almost 20-25 days after compared to other areas), positively influencing color and sensory profile.
The choice to allocate a single vineyard, Mandrie, exclusively to the production of Valpolicella , without previously selecting the grapes for Amarone, reflects the company’s will to enhance this wine as much as possible.
The varieties used are specifically 45% of Corvina, 45% of Corvinone and 10% Rondinella. Quanto a particular, the Vite delle Mandrie presents a south-west exhibition, with limb-sabbious soils, rich durante organic substance, where it has been planted mainly Corvina, while the western part is characterized by poorer and more pebble soils, cultivated durante Corvinone.
Vinification and organoleptic characteristics
The 2022 harvest, carried out manually, began the second week of October. Red vinification provides for the contact of the skins for the entire fermentative process, with two daily reassembly and a half -stalia half -star to optimize the extraction of the color and the polyphenolic component. The fermentation is conducted at a controlled temperature of 22 ° -24 ° C, preserving the freshest and most delicate flavors.
Quanto a mid -November, the wine was transferred to 20 hectoliters barrels, where it continued its maturation for about a year and a half, until April 2024. Subsequently it was stuffed durante June, completing a further refinement, durante the bottle, before its release acceso the market.
Valpolicella Vacie 2022 presents itself with a bright ruby red color. The nose emerges hints of mature cherry, balsamic agenda and a delicate spicy, conferred by the marked thermal excursions. Quanto a the mouth, well integrated acidity supports the structure, enhancing aromatic complexity and guaranteeing balance between concentration and tannic finesse.
